#223345 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#223345 is composed of 13.3% red, 20%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.7% cyan, 26.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 210.9 degrees, a saturation of 34% and a lightness of 20.2%. #223345 color hex could be obtained by blending #44668a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#223345 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#223345 has RGB values of R:34, G:51,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 2241349.

Shades and Tints of #223345
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f5f8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#223345
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#323335 is the less saturated color, while #023265 is the most saturated one.
